Transaction 87edaecf8d6f36a7b3a34f28cfe0f9fa8a6d139e49ec1393f96e2e42600aeb20

block
29629b60db258f67184c23957065eb7264cbbe48b76428594e130307a75197f2

1 Input

3 Outputs